How Our Team Handles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ration

When water damage hits your laminate floors, it’s essential to act fast. Our team’s process is designed to reduce downtime and prevent further damage. We start by assessing the damage, identifying the source of the leak, and extracting excess water using specialized equipment.

Step 1: Assessment and Leak Detection

Our technicians will inspect your floors, walls, and ceilings to find out the extent of the damage. We’ll identify the source of the leak and recommend a plan to repair or replace damaged parts. Our team uses thermal imaging cameras to detect hidden water damage and ensure a thorough assessment.

Step 2: Water Removal and Extraction

We’ll use specialized equipment, such as wet/dry vacuums and extractors, to remove excess water from your floors and underlying structures.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and reducing drying time. Our technicians work efficiently to reduce downtime and get your floors back in shape.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Once the water has been removed, we’ll use industrial-grade dehumidifiers and fans to dry your floors and surrounding areas. This step is critical in preventing mold growth and further damage. Our team monitors the drying process to ensure your floors are completely dry before proceeding.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

After the drying process is complete, we’ll clean and sanitize your floors to remove any remaining moisture and prevent bacterial growth. This step is essential in ensuring your floors are safe to walk on and look their best. Our technicians use eco-friendly cleaning products to protect your floors and the environment.

Step 5: Repair and Replacement

Finally, we’ll repair or replace any damaged parts, such as flooring, baseboards, or drywall. Our team will work with you to ensure the repairs meet your standards and exceed your expectations. Our technicians are skilled craftsmen who take pride in their work.

Warning Signs You Need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ration

Water damage can be sneaky, and it’s often hard to spot the signs. But ignoring these warning signs can lead to costly repairs and health risks. Here are some common indicators of laminate floor water damage: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

When water damage occurs, it can leave behind a lingering musty smell. This odor is a sign that mold and mildew are growing, and if left unchecked, it can spread to other areas of your home. Don’t ignore the smell; it’s a sign that you need professional help.

Warped or Buckled Laminate Flooring

Water damage can cause your laminate flooring to warp or buckle, creating uneven surfaces and tripping hazards. This is a safety concern and it’s essential to address it quickly to prevent accidents.

Water Stains on Your Walls or Ceiling

Water damage can leave behind unsightly stains on your walls or ceiling. These stains are a sign of water seepage and can lead to further damage if left untreated. Don’t delay; contact us today to schedule a consultation.

Discoloration or Bubbling on Your Laminate Floors

Water damage can cause your laminate floors to discolor or bubble, creating unsightly patterns and uneven surfaces. Don’t ignore these signs; they show that your floors need professional attention.

Unusual Bumps or Swelling on Your Laminate Floors

Water damage can cause your laminate floors to become uneven, creating bumps or swelling. This is a sign of water seepage and it’s essential to address it quickly to prevent further damage.

Mold or Mildew Growing on Your Walls or Ceiling

Mold and mildew can grow quickly in damp environments, and if left unchecked, it can spread to other areas of your home. Don’t ignore these signs; they show that you need professional help to prevent health risks and further damage.

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water spill on a single laminate floor plank Yes No You can easily clean and dry the affected area yourself.
Water damage affecting multiple laminate floor planks No Yes You need specialized equipment and expertise to prevent further damage and ensure a thorough drying process.
Musty odors or warping/buckling laminate flooring No Yes These signs show mold or mildew growth, and you need professional help to prevent health risks and further damage.
Water stains on your walls or ceiling No Yes Water seepage can lead to further damage if left untreated, and you need professional help to address the issue.
Large water spill or flood affecting your entire home No Yes You need specialized equipment and expertise to prevent further damage and ensure a thorough drying process.

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ration Cost In Bedford, MA

The cost of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ration in Bedford, MA, var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. But, here’s a rough estimate of what you might expect to pay: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water removal and ext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, amount of water, and equipment used
Dehumidification and drying $300 – $1,500 Size of affected area, type of equipment used, and drying time
Cleaning and sanitizing $200 – $1,000 Type of cleaning products used, size of affected area, and level of soiling
Repair and replacement $1,000 – $5,000 Severity of damage, type of materials used, and labor costs
